For over a century, Sport Club Português (SCP) has been a beacon of Portuguese culture, language, and traditions, serving as a vibrant hub for the local community. Rooted in the heart of Newark’s Ironbound section, SCP’s mission is to preserve and promote the rich heritage of Portugal, ensuring it thrives and inspires future generations. Through a diverse array of programs and initiatives, SCP brings people together, fostering a deep sense of identity and pride among its members.
Passing on Culture Through Education: The Luís de Camões Portuguese School
At the core of SCP’s mission is the Luís de Camões Portuguese School, where the next generation learns the Portuguese language and explores the country’s traditions, literature, and history. This school is more than just a place of learning; it’s a bridge connecting young minds to their ancestral roots, fostering a love for their heritage and ensuring it endures. By providing a structured and engaging curriculum, the school empowers students to embrace their cultural identity and carry it proudly into the future.
Celebrating Tradition Through Dance: Camponeses do Minho
The Camponeses do Minho folkloric group is a living celebration of Portugal’s vibrant dance and musical traditions. With both youth and adult ensembles, the group showcases traditional costumes, music, and choreography from the Minho region. For the younger generation, participation in Camponeses do Minho is an opportunity to immerse themselves in their cultural heritage and connect with their roots. For adults, it’s a chance to honor their history and share their traditions with the community. These performances are a testament to SCP’s commitment to keeping the spirit of Portuguese folklore alive.

Soccer for All Ages: Building Community Through Sport
Soccer has long been a cornerstone of SCP’s identity, uniting members through their shared passion for the sport. SCP’s soccer program offers opportunities for players aged 18 and up, including an over-40 team that caters to members who want to stay active, enjoy the game, and bond with friends. Beyond competition, these teams embody the camaraderie and teamwork that define SCP, creating lasting memories both on and off the field. Soccer at SCP is more than just a game; it’s a tradition that connects generations.

Riding with Pride: Lusófonos Risers
The Lusófonos Risers, SCP’s biker club, adds another dynamic layer to the organization’s offerings. This group unites members who share a passion for motorcycles and a love of Portuguese culture. Through rides and events, the Lusófonos Risers embody the adventurous spirit and camaraderie that SCP cultivates, promoting a sense of belonging and pride.
